In the second episode of the 8 Decades Podcast, Josiah Freeland delves into the 1960s with his grandfather Steve, exploring significant milestones like the introduction of zip codes, the Civil Rights Movement, President Kennedy's assassination, and the moon landing. Through personal stories and historical insights, they examine social changes, technological advances, and the cultural landscape that defined this pivotal decade in American history.
